Cassette Futurism UI design style

Chunky analog controls, CRT displays, industrial panels, physical switches, amber or green screens, and late-20th-century science-fiction technology.

Signature elements
CRT displays, chunky switches, industrial panels, amber readouts, physical labels, analog instrumentation. In daisyUI themes, set `--depth: 1;`.
Best suited to
Games, developer tools, media players, science-fiction products, and immersive entertainment.
Layout principles
Build the interface as a heavy modular console with a dominant CRT, adjacent hardware bays, physical status strips, and labels attached directly to controls.

History and origins

A fact-checked account of where this visual language came from, with links to the references used.

Period
Source period from the mid-1970sโ€“late 1980s; named retrospectively online
Origin
Industrial technology, analog media, film, and television

Cassette Futurism is a retrospective internet label for futures imagined with tape decks, CRTs, membrane keys, switches, and bulky modular hardware. CARI places its source period from the mid-1970s to late 1980s and records the name as a later coinage on TV Tropes, meaning the original production designers did not generally use it for their own work.

Color direction

Use charcoal, military olive, beige plastic, and worn metal with amber or green phosphor displays and small red warning indicators. In a daisyUI theme, use amber or green phosphor for `primary`, military olive for `secondary`, and step `base-100`, `base-200`, and `base-300` through charcoal, near-black metal, and black.

Imagery direction

Use chunky switches, tape decks, CRT readouts, cables, vents, industrial labels, and late-century spacecraft or computer hardware.

Content density

Support high density through clearly separated physical panels, engraved legends, and dedicated readout zones rather than floating digital cards. Use the `*-sm` size variants for daisyUI components to preserve this compact working density.

Motion direction

Use CRT boot sequences, scan refresh, tape motion, switch snaps, relay delays, and occasional signal dropout with believable hardware response.

Shape language

Favor boxy housings, vents, recessed screens, chunky toggles, rotary knobs, handles, screws, and thick molded bezels. In daisyUI themes, set the `--radius-*` variables between `0.25rem` and `1rem`.

Typography rules

Use monospaced phosphor text for displays and condensed industrial lettering for panel labels, keeping terminology terse and mechanically aligned.
